Major problem in cognitive radio network is frequent handoff between the spectrum bands which is sensed to be idle for the usage of the secondary users. Whenever the spectrum is utilized by the primary users the secondary user has to be looking for the free idle band in order to avoid the interference between the licensed and unlicensed user because of which the handoff between the secondary have been increasing between the idle spectrum bands. To avoid the frequent handoff and the efficient usage of spectrum of bands we propose a new power allocation algorithm. This algorithm not only adjusts the transmission power of the secondary user but also provides interference constraint between the primary and secondary user, through which the secondary user can obtain more spectrum for the usage.
